Description:

Orchestrated services often need passwords and secrets to be propagated to multiple servers and set in configuration files or admin tools.

Currently the only practical way of doing this is to define template parameters for passwords and specify the password value on stack create. This can become a burden for complex templates with many services. For example these tripleo examples ask the user to generate 13 random passwords to pass to stack-create:
http://docs.openstack.org/developer/tripleo-incubator/devtest.html

This blueprint suggests creating a resource type OS::Heat::RandomString which randomly generates a string that can be accessed via an attribute. Properties can be set to specify what kind of string to generate, but defaults would aim to generate a string which is appropriate for service and user passwords that heat templates typically configure.

The resource's string will be stored in resource data and will be persisted by heat for the lifecycle of the stack. A future modification could be to store the string on a key server like Barbican.
